Place the udon noodles from the package into a large, heatproof bowl.

Cover the noodles completely with boiling hot water. Let them sit for approximately 4 minutes to cook, or according to package directions.

While the noodles are cooking, prepare the sauce in a separate medium-sized bowl. Add the peanut butter, soy sauce, sesame oil, honey, and minced garlic to the bowl.

Whisk these sauce ingredients together until well combined and relatively smooth.

Add the hot water to the sauce mixture and continue to whisk until the sauce is smooth and fully combined, resembling a 'lovely satay-type sauce'.

Once the udon noodles are cooked, carefully drain them thoroughly.

Add the drained noodles directly into the bowl with the prepared peanut sauce.

Using chopsticks or tongs, mix the noodles thoroughly into the sauce until they are fully coated and evenly distributed.

Divide the peanut udon noodles among serving bowls. Top each serving with finely chopped spring onions, a sprinkle of sesame seeds, and chili flakes to taste.
